Wheatland County’s Agricultural Service Board(ASB) will be packing into the bus for their yearly tour of the community on August 23.

“The main purpose is to showcase the agi-businesses around the county and show our industry leading producers off to whomever would like to see, and maybe learn a little bit more about the industry that feeds the world,” said Jason Wilson, Wheatland County councillor.

The tour is open to the public, but participants will also include county councilors, agricultural service board members, and Wilson who will be acting as a tour guide and master of ceremonies.

Wilson explained that invitations have also been extended to Newell County, and the Town of Strathmore.

“It’s really open to whoever wants to learn about the ag industry,” said Wilson.

The tour is from 8:30 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. with 55 spots available on the bus, at a cost of $45 per person.

Featured on the tour will be a lunch by The Country Farmhouse and taste testing at Origin Malting and Brewing in Strathmore.

The bus tour is held on an annual basis throughout Wheatland County. Participants will be visiting the Strathmore Seed Cleaning Plant, Origin Malting and Brewing – Barley to Beer, the Carseland Feedyards Ltd., and Heritage Harvest.

“My favourite place on the stop is actually Origin (Malting &) Brewing. It’s the new brewery in town and we are going to have the barley to beer aspect of it,” said Wilson. “We are going to be touring one of the farms of the Hiltons and then moving into the brewery and having lunch there,” he said. The experience allows visitors to understand what it takes to make craft beer, he explained.

“You really understand what it takes to make that craft beer, the work that goes into it, and how much a family can change the economy,” he said.

The ASB is comprised of elected council members. The board promotes and enhances sustainable agriculture with a view to improving the economic viability of the agricultural producer, according to Wheatland County. They also advise county council and the Minister of Agriculture on matters of mutual concern, and develop agricultural policies within the county.
